Ingredients:

  • 1.5 lb chicken breast, cut into 1-inch cubes
  • 1 tbsp avocado oil
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per
  • 1/3 cup low-sodium soy sauce
  • 2 tbsp honey
  • 1 tbsp toasted sesame oil
  • 1 tbsp fresh ginger, minced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tsp rice vinegar
  • 4 cups zucchini noodles
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tbsp toasted sesame seeds
  • 2 stalks green onions, thinly sliced

Instructions:

  1. Whisk together the soy sauce, honey, sesame oil, minced ginger, garlic, and rice vinegar in a small bowl. Stir until the honey is fully dissolved and set it aside.
  2. Pat the zucchini noodles dry with a paper towel. Note: This prevents the Sesame Chicken Zoodles from becoming watery.
  3. Heat the avocado oil in a large skillet over medium high heat until it starts shimmering.
  4. Add the cubed chicken breast in a single layer. Don't crowd the pan or the chicken will steam instead of brown.
  5. Sear the chicken without moving it for 3-4 minutes until a mahogany colored crust forms.
  6. Flip the chicken and cook for another 3 minutes until golden and cooked through.
  7. Pour the prepared sauce over the chicken. Stir constantly for 2-3 minutes. The sauce will bubble and turn into a velvety glaze that coats the meat.
  8. Remove the chicken from the pan and put it on a plate.
  9. Add olive oil to the same pan. Toss in the zucchini noodles and sauté for 2-3 minutes until just tender but still snappy.
  10. Return the chicken to the pan, toss with the zoodles, and garnish with sesame seeds and green onions.
